    Nanomedic's wound care system spins out skin-like dressing

    If Marvel’s Peter Parker had chosen to apply his graduate work in biochemistry and his web-shooters to medicine, he might have created something like Nanomedic Technologies Ltd.’s Spincare system. The system uses a hand-held medical gun that prints a flexible, transparent layer of artificial skin directly on a wound or burn. The Electrospun Healing Fiber (EHF) technology creates a waterproof, protective nano polymer matrix.

    Patensee launches first-in-human trial of integrated surveillance system for fistula stenosis

    Patensee Ltd. initiated a first-in-human trial of its machine vision-based surveillance system for stenosis in hemodialysis patients. The trial will evaluate the imaging system's ability to perform contact-free surveillance of the access points or fistulas essential for dialysis, which nearly all narrow or become blocked over time. The surveillance system aims to mimic the central components of a dialysis nurse's exam using technology.

    Rsip Vision develops AI-based coronary artery segmentation tool

    HONG KONG – Rsip Vision Ltd. have developed a new coronary artery segmentation tool based on deep learning technology that should allow for faster 3D models of coronary artery anatomy and facilitate precise measurements of artery length and diameter.
